Abstract
鉛直回転軸のまわりに、複数の縦方向のブレードをほぼ等間隔で設けた揚力型の風力発電用風車において、各ブレードを前部ブレードと後部ブレードに縦方向に二分して記後部ブレードを前部ブレードに対して分割線を回転軸に回動可能に軸支し、各前部ブレードを鉛直回転軸側に傾斜させた風力発電用の風車と発電装置。風速に応じて後部ブレードが回動し起動時または微風下ではサボニウス型の抗力型として機能し、高速時にはジャイロ型の揚力型として機能する。発電機は、鉛直回転軸の下方に設置され、風車と同軸的に連結される。
